What Are Some Examples Of E-commerce Acquisitions? 

Many companies are looking to gain more competitive advantage in the e-commerce marketplace by making acquisitions of smaller, emerging online retailers. This can lead to an increase in profits and a higher customer base for the buyer. However, there are some important things to consider before deciding on whether or not to make an acquisition.

One of the most common reasons that e-commerce firms are acquiring others is to obtain more products to sell to their customers. This is a great way for e-commerce companies to improve their margins. It also allows them to expand their reach to new customers, who might not have shopped with them in the past. 

Another reason that e-commerce businesses are acquiring other firms is to gain access to new marketing strategies. This can include ad networks, email campaigns, and social media channels. 

A third reason why e-commerce companies are acquiring other companies is to acquire talent and expertise. This can include executives and employees with new ideas and the ability to keep up with the rapidly changing e-commerce landscape. 

This can also be a way for larger e-commerce firms to gain expertise in certain areas, such as marketing or customer service. This can help them in a variety of ways, including improving the quality of their products or services.

Buying these firms can also allow e-commerce companies to expand their sales in particular retail niches. This can be a great way for e-commerce companies that have not yet expanded their sales into specific areas to get a jump start on the competition. 

When a company purchases an e-commerce firm, it must perform due diligence on the business. This can include looking at the product line, the customers and the management team. It can also involve reviewing the business’s financial statements, tax returns, and more. 

The due diligence process will also ensure that the e-commerce company is in compliance with any local laws or regulations. This can be especially important for e-commerce companies that are expanding internationally or to new countries. 

A fourth reason that e-commerce companies are acquiring other firms is to obtain better data on their customers. This can help e-commerce companies to create personalized and customized products that their customers will enjoy. 

These companies can also help e-commerce businesses gain more insight into how their customers interact with them. This can help e-commerce companies understand how they can better engage their customers and get them to purchase more products. 

Having this information is important because it can allow e-commerce companies to improve their products and services, as well as give them the opportunity to make more accurate predictions about their future sales.
